Description

The Pokémon Adventure: Pokémon Emergency! game was intended to be the first of twelve "Pokémon RPG" supplements, but due to licensing matters, the rest were never published.

The game is a simplified RPG style game where the players take the role of Pokémon Trainers. The (D/G)M takes the controls of the game and narrates the players through some adventures.

The components of the game are several of the basic Pokémon and a D6. The attacks of each Pokémon have a difficulty, and if you roll one of the numbers that make the attack succeed, the attack succeeds.

A clever and simple system, the D6 system is a very good way to run some simplified RPG games with your non-dicechucking friends. It goes great with games similar to Heroquest for those who don't like difficult rules.

This game is also a great way of getting younger players into the gaming hobby and introduce them to RPGs.
